Weather Overview

The India Meteorological Department (IMD) has confirmed that a low-pressure system over the Bay of Bengal is expected to intensify, leading to heavy rainfall across Maharashtra. Areas including Raigad, Ghats, and Sangli are under a red alert, indicating severe weather conditions. Furthermore, various other districts in the region will experience significant rainfall, which may cause localized flooding and landslides.

Districts Affected

The districts specifically noted for heightened risk include:

  • Raigad: Anticipated as one of the hardest-hit areas, residents should take preventive measures.
  • Ghats: This hilly region may face landslides due to incessant rainfall.
  • Sangli: Expect disruptions in transportation and essential services due to heavy downpours.
  • Other districts with warnings include Thane, Pune, and Solapur.

Safety Tips

In light of these weather warnings, it is crucial for residents to prioritize safety. Here are some tips to consider:

  • Stay updated with weather forecasts and alerts from local authorities.
  • Avoid unnecessary travel, especially in flood-prone areas.
  • Prepare an emergency kit that includes essentials such as food, water, and first-aid supplies.
  • Ensure your property is secure; clear gutters and drains to prevent water accumulation.
  • Have an evacuation plan in place in case conditions worsen.
